- Stabilizing additives for such recording sheets containing porous inorganic oxides need to be sufficiently soluble and compatible with the other ingredients of the mainly aqueous coating compositions. They need to be colorless or are allowed to be colored only slightly. Furthermore, these additives need to be stable when the recording sheets or the images printed thereon are stored over long periods and they are not allowed to yellow. Additionally they need to be non-toxic and inoffensive.

- images produced by ink jet printing may be protected from degradation by the addition of radical scavengers, stabilizers, reducing agents and antioxidants.
- radical scavengers examples include sterically hindered phenols, sterically hindered amines, chromanols, ascorbic acid, phosphinic acid and its derivatives, sulfur containing compounds such as sulfides, mercaptans, thiocyanates, thioamides or thioureas.
- Coatings with other additives mentioned in the relevant documents of the state of the art namely 2,6-di-tert-butyl-4-methyl-phenol (Patent GB 2,088,777), sodium thiocyanate (Patent application EP 0,685,345) and 3,4-dimethoxybenzoic acid (Patent application EP 0,373,573) could not be prepared, because coating solutions containing these compounds showed precipitation or extremely high viscosities.
